In modern residences, choosing to grow lettuce on the balcony is a more practical method. Let's learn about it from the following.

How to grow lettuce on the balcony How to grow lettuce on the balcony

1. First of all, we need to select lettuce seeds. We all know that good seeds are the decisive factor in cultivating excellent varieties of vegetables. In the process of lettuce growth, the cultivation environment and technology are one aspect, and the quality of seeds is also crucial. Choose the best quality lettuce seeds and plant them on the balcony to cultivate the taste we like.

2. For lettuce planted on the balcony, because the light may not meet the requirements of outdoor cultivation, it is necessary to move the planting pots according to the light conditions. It is best to place it on a sunny windowsill, so that the lettuce can absorb enough sunlight for photosynthesis. The nutritional source of green vegetables is guaranteed.

3. When planting lettuce on the balcony, generally due to the limited space, the amount that can be planted is relatively small. In order to get as much lettuce as possible and make planting more practical, you can choose some long flower beds and place them on the balcony. This can ensure the planting amount and still meet our daily needs. Just water it appropriately, it's very simple.
